    <description>The Tribunal ruled in favor of the assessee, holding that the block assessment order under section 158BD of the Income Tax Act was time-barred due to a delay in issuing the notice. The delay of more than three years in initiating proceedings after the completion of assessment in the searched person&#039;s case was deemed unreasonable. As a result, the order was quashed, emphasizing the importance of timely issuance of notices in block assessment proceedings to adhere to statutory provisions and avoid being time-barred.</description>
